FUNERAL OF VICTIMS
OF MONDAY TRAGEDY
The funerals of Evangeline Garza and Alberto Garza, the victims of Monday's dual tragedy, were held yesterday afternoon, both being attended by large number of friends.
The funeral of Mrs. Garza was conducted according to the rights of the Catholic Church, while that of her husband was conducted according to the ritual of the American Legion, of which he was a member.
More than thirty former servicemen attended the funeral of their dead comrade in arms, most of them being overseas men. The services were conducted by Chaplain Flowers of the Volunteers of America, himself a former servicemen.
The Funerals were held at different hours, both bodies being laid to rest in the City Cemetery.
(Evangelina was shot to death by her husband on Monday.)
